Ingredients for Taco Pasta
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ious Taco Pasta:
8 oz Penne pasta – Used for its delightful shape that holds onto the sauce beautifully. You can substitute with any pasta you love.
1 lb Ground beef – Provides that hearty base, but feel free to swap it with ground turkey or a plant-based option for a lighter dish.
1 cup Diced tomatoes – Adds a juicy burst of flavor and moisture, enhancing the overall richness of the dish.
1 cup Corn – Sweet kernels that contribute a pop of color and a hint of sweetness. Frozen corn works just as well!
1 cup Black beans – Packed with protein and fiber, they bring a satisfying texture and flavor to your pasta.
1 cup Bell pepper – Choose red, yellow, or green for sweetness and crunch; they brighten up the dish visually and flavor-wise.
1 cup Onion – Gives depth and a savory aroma as it cooks down in the pan.
1 packet Taco seasoning – The magic mix of spices that ties all flavors together, making it unmistakably taco-esque.
1 tsp Garlic powder – Adds a punch of flavor that makes every bite irresistible.
1 tsp Onion powder – Enhances the savory notes without overwhelming the dish.
1 tsp Chili powder – Offers a mild kick; adjust more if you love heat!
1 cup Shredded cheddar cheese – For that gooey, melty goodness. Mix it up with Monterey Jack for a twist!
1 cup Sour cream – A creamy topping that adds a cool and tangy finish to the warm pasta.
1 cup Chopped cilantro – Freshness that brightens up the whole experience. Feel free to skip if it’s not your thing.
How to Make Taco Pasta
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ious Taco Pasta:
Step 1: Cook the Pasta
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il, then add the penne pasta. Cook according to package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side, ready for the taco transformation.
Step 2: Brown the Beef
In a large skillet over medium heat, brown the ground beef until it’s fully cooked. Remember to break it apart with a spatula! Drain any excess fat to keep your dish from becoming greasy.
Step 3: Add the Veggies
Stir in the diced tomatoes, corn, black beans, bell pepper, onion, taco seasoning, garlic powder, onion powder, and chili powder. Cook for about 5-10 minutes until the bell pepper and onions are tender and the flavors meld beautifully.
Step 4: Combine Everything
Add the cooked pasta to the skillet, stirring until everything is well combined and evenly coated with the savory sauce. The colors will be as vibrant as a fiesta!
Step 5: Melt the Cheese
Finally, sprinkle the shredded cheddar cheese over the pasta mixture, cover the skillet, and let it sit for a minute until the cheese becomes deliciously melty and gooey.
Step 6: Serve with Style
Transfer generous portions onto plates or bowls, dolloping sour cream on top, and sprinkle with freshly chopped cilantro. This Taco Pasta is now ready to take center stage at your dinner table.

Storing & Reheating Taco Pasta
Store leftover Taco Pasta in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. Reheat gently on the stove with a splash of water to retain moisture and flavor.

How long does it take to make Taco Pasta?
Preparing Taco Pasta is incredibly quick and straightforward. From start to finish, you can have this mouthwatering meal on your table in just 30 minutes. With 10 minutes of prep time and 20 minutes of cooking, it’s an excellent option for busy evenings or when you have unexpected guests. Can I customize my Taco Pasta?
Absolutely! Taco Pasta is very versatile, inviting you to unleash your inner chef. Swap out ground beef for ground turkey, chicken, or even a plant-based protein for a healthier twist. Feel free to toss in additional vegetables like zucchini or use different types of cheese, such as pepper jack for a spicy kick.
